It's time for our Panda 4x4 to find a new home.

The basics:

  • 131.7K miles (call it 132K between friends!) That number may go up, but only slightly - the Panda's been usurped by the i3 behind it.
  • I'm the 6th owner, and have owned it for the last 2.5 years.
  • It has a full service history - proper full, not 'it's only missed 50% of services' that seems to constitute a FSH these days! It came without a service book and with the assistance of the supplying dealer I've reconstructed it - all stamped up (bar two - one of which has the invoice, and a car dealer who refused to re-stamp it because just unhelpful :() Last service was at 131.3K
  • Two keys, one remote, one manual.

Everyone will look up its MOT history anyway, so not much to say there tbh.

I have invoices for everything I've spent on it getting it back up to the condition you can see in the google photo folder. Amongst which are:

Clutch, DMF & concentric slave replacement.
Successfully chasing down & fixing the cause of its occasional smoking on DPF regen (leaking injectors)
New AC condenser.
Suspension parts, various.
Replacing OE plastic wheel with a later leather one.
Fixing a split drivers seat bolster with a leather insert, well-matched to the OE vinyl.
Recent Yuasa battery.
Rear diff & gearbox oil change using proper spec Tutela fluids.
Removal, cleaning & lubrication of gear selector pin on top of gearbox.
Uprated headlamp bulbs.
Tailored rubber mats all round, incl. boot.
Door entry plates x5
Fitting 185/65 all season tyres (same size tyre as the Cross) plus 5mm spacers on the front wheels to ensure no rubbing at full lock because of the slightly different wheel offset. Treads of each are photographed, and scientifically measured as 'plenty'
Regular alignments due to the 3rd World roads hereabouts, last a couple of months ago.

I'll also include 4 litres of Fuchs oil, a fuel filter and an oil filter, so that's the next service covered. Oh, and an external temperature sensor for the budding diy auto electrician to fit if desired - it was beyond my limited capabilities I'm ashamed to say ;)

It's a properly sorted, honest little Panda that has many years service left from its mighty Multijet! The mpg figure on the dash is over the last 5K or so miles IIRC - it won't go below 50 mpg in our hands, no matter what we do.
